Transaction 7320dedeb51a876c483f4b79cf6c36e44e31667e9f788073ccd284e763bfbc6c

7 Input
2 Outputs
  • 7320dedeb51a876c483f4b79cf6c36e44e31667e9f788073ccd284e763bfbc6c:0
  • value  2375000
    address  1HaggT3wDF23BFDcwLbAwxd1vs64pYZtCd
  • 7320dedeb51a876c483f4b79cf6c36e44e31667e9f788073ccd284e763bfbc6c:1
  • value  25780
    address  3Qrhw27x4baSjxtiFZGMRWzEEGpiS9Ve86